Description
Chicken Tzatziki Rice Bake is a delicious and easy-to-make 30-minute meal that’s perfect for busy weeknights. Tender chicken is baked to perfection and smothered in a creamy, flavorful tzatziki sauce, all atop a bed of fluffy rice. This comforting dish is sure to become a family favorite.
Ingredients
– 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cubed
– 1 cup uncooked white rice
– 1 cup plain Greek yogurt
– 1 cucumber, grated
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 tbsp fresh dill, chopped
– 1 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ped
– 1 tsp lemon juice
– 1/2 tsp salt
– 1/4 tsp black pepper
Instructions
1. 1. Preheat oven to 375°F.
2. 2. In a large bowl, mix together the Greek yogurt, grated cucumber, garlic, dill, parsley, lemon juice, salt, and pepper to make the tzatziki sauce. Set aside.
3. 3. Place the cubed chicken in a baking dish and pour the tzatziki sauce over the top, making sure the chicken is evenly coated.
4. 4.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the sauce is bubbly.
5. 5. Meanwhile, cook the rice according to package instructions.
6. 6. Serve the Chicken Tzatziki Rice Bake warm, with the rice on the side.
Notes
For extra flavor, you can add a sprinkle of feta cheese or chopped kalamata olives to the dish. The leftovers also make a great lunch the next day.
